2014-09-14 2 views
-3

je fixe mais ne marche pas tout le monde sait comment peut transmettre des données de UITableView à l'intérieur de UICollectionView DOG.hEchanger des données entre UITableView et UICollectionView

+0

Vous ne définissez nulle part dans votre méthode 'prepareForSegue: sender:' des données sur votre viewcontroller de destination. Par conséquent, aucune donnée ne lui est transmise. Je m'attendrais à une ligne comme 'destviewcontroller.dogDetails = quelque chose ' –

+0

@roboticcat ce que devrait l'assigner. – m34

+0

Je n'en ai aucune idée. Vous seul connaissez votre application et les informations que vous souhaitez transmettre au VC de destination. Configurez les propriétés dans le conteneur virtuel de destination correspondant aux informations que vous souhaitez transmettre, puis définissez les propriétés dans la méthode 'prepareForSegue: expéditeur:'. Il existe de nombreux exemples sur StackOverflow et Internet. –

Répondre

2
-(void)ViewDidLoad{ 

devrait être

-(void)viewDidLoad{ 

aussi [super viewDidLoad]; devrait être appelé.


Le code que vous avez publié ne peut même pas être compilé. Il n'y a pas de directive @synthesis. Êtes-vous à la traîne?

Questions connexes